The Annihilator Battleship is a Tier 6 hull with the ability to resist Alien Damage.

As a battleship, this ship has bonus range and duplicate weapons for each firing arc, dealing massive damage from a safe distance.

Strategy and Setup

Advantages

The Annihilator Battleship sets a new standard for battleships with increased turning speed. When equipped with Xeno Armored Thrusters, even Alien Reapers find it difficult to get inside its blind spot. This ship can also change directions faster, making them agiler than Hellfire Battleships overall.

Its long range is best exploited through the use of Xeno Shatter Driver, allowing it to kite other battleships and eradicate cruiser fleets with ease.

Similar to other battleships, it has a dual firing arc, enabling Annihilator Battleships equipped with Xeno Rupture Beams to quickly dispatch swarms of Alien Reapers.

Disadvantages

The Annihilator Battleship is a true glass cannon with minimal defensive slots. They are countered by Exterminator Destroyers which are more durable and have even longer range, as well as speedy Decimator Cutters, potentially destroying them in a single firing cycle.

Pure Xeno Shatter Driver builds are extremely weak to squadrons, so be sure to reserve a couple of Xeno Seeker Missiles to destroy them. Punisher Cruisers are often used alongside Annihilator Battleships to buy more time for them to deal damage to the enemy fleet.

Trivia

  • The Annihilator Battleship has +2 deg/s turning compared to previous battleships. However, it is not considered as a Class X ship.
  • The circular part of the Annihilator Battleship near the front spins during combat.
  • This ship originally had a huge hitbox, resulting in many player complaints. Its size was drastically reduced in a subsequent update.
